文摘In this paper, a hybrid dividend strategy in the compound Poisson risk model is considered. In the absence of dividends, the surplus of an insurance company is modelled by a compound Poisson process. Dividends are paid at a constant rate whenever the modified surplus is in a interval;the premium income no longer goes into the surplus but is paid out as dividends whenever the modified surplus exceeds the upper bound of the interval, otherwise no dividends are paid. Integro-differential equations with boundary conditions satisfied by the expected total discounted dividends until ruin are derived;for example, closed-form solutions are given when claims are exponentially distributed. Accordingly, the moments and moment-generating functions of total discounted dividends until ruin are considered. Finally, the Gerber-Shiu function and Laplace transform of the ruin time are discussed.
文摘The productivity of medical staff within a polyclinic is not an easy task due to the multiple activities that physicians must perform at the same time: not only healthcare for patients, but also academic activities, such as scientific research and teaching. Hybrid professionals are healthcare professionals who have to play multiple roles, often not precisely identified. This analysis examines the case study of the University Polyclinic of Messina (Italy) where three university departments and 7 Dipartimenti di Attività Integrate (DAI) are distinguished and physicians (both professors and researchers) are called to reconcile multiple tasks. Given the distinction between university departments and DAIs, the aim of this contribution is to identify the organizational elements that prove to be predictors of scientific efficiency and productivity. To what extent does the inclusion in a DAI or within a university department affect individual incentives? A new dataset is built for the present research containing information on University Polyclinic of Messina physicians (full professors, associate professors, researchers). From the Scopus online database (<a href="https://www.scopus.com/home.uri">https://www.scopus.com/home.uri</a>) individual information relating to the number of publications, the number of citations, h-index was obtained. The latter is used to assess the quality of individual research;in order to evaluate the teaching activity, the number of hours dedicated to didactical activities is taken into account, together with the number of teaching hours required by one’s role. Information related to remuneration and the circumstance of carrying out intramural activities has also been included. A thorough statistical analysis is carried out and the individual groups (DAI and university departments) are compared through the Kruskal Wallis test. Estimating a Poisson Gamma mixture model highlights those variables that are significant predictors of scientific productivity. Attention paid to organizational methods should allow identifying the ideal setting for hybrid professionals to practice the medical profession, while carrying out managerial duties, without compromising the quality of teaching and research. An efficient solution could thus be proposed to the complex multi-objective optimization problem that healthcare professionals are called to answer.
文摘This paper presents mathematics models that describe and optimize the passenger flow at the airport security checkpoints by applying the queuing theory. Firstly, a Poisson process is used to estimate the flow of passengers waiting for going through the security. Then, the Poisson distribution is combined with a multiple M/M/s model. Following that, an arrival model (passengers’ arriving at the checkpoints preparing for security examination and departure) with Gumbel extreme value estimation is described that predicts the busiest time in the busiest airport. Real case data collected from several major airports worldwide is used for creating a hybrid Poisson model to generate the simulation of passenger volume. At last, Markov Chain theory is applied to the analysis to randomly simulate the flow of enplaned passengers again, and the results of these two simulations are compared and discussed, revealing that the hybrid Poisson model is the more accurate one. After successfully characterizing the passenger flow mathematically, two methods for optimizing the passenger flow are then provided in two different respects: one is bypassing passengers and creating an express pass;while the other one promotes Pre-Check service application.

文摘A class of hybrid jump diffusions modulated by a Markov chain is considered in this work. The motivation stems from insurance risk models, and emerging applications in production planning and wireless communications. The models are hybrid in that they involve both continuous dynamics and discrete events. Under suitable conditions, asymptotic expansions of the transition densities for the underlying processes are developed, The formal expansions are validated and the error bounds obtained.

文摘Allele-specifc expression refers to the preferential expression of one of the two alleles in a diploid genome,which has been thought largely attributable to the associated cis-element variation and allele-specifc epigenetic modifcation patterns.Allele-specifc expression may contribute to the heterosis(or hybrid vigor) effect in hybrid plants that are produced from crosses of closely-related species,subspecies and/or inbred lines.In this study,using Illumina high-throughput sequencing of maize transcriptomics,chromatic H3K27me3 histone modifcation and DNA methylation data,we developed a new computational framework to identify allele-specifcally expressed genes by simultaneously tracking allele-specifc gene expression patterns and the epigenetic modifcation landscape in the seedling tissues of hybrid maize.This approach relies on detecting nucleotide polymorphisms and any genomic structural variation between two parental genomes in order to distinguish paternally or maternally derived sequencing reads.This computational pipeline also incorporates a modifed Chi-square test to statistically identify allele-specifc gene expression and epigenetic modifcation based on the Poisson distribution.
